学习服务器 --- 1、阿里云服务器的购买与SSH远程连接云主机的两种方式

对于一个前端来说拥有个自己的服务器还是很有必要的,可以在自己的世界里搞点事情- - ,在这里记录一下自己的学习过程。

购买服务器

我购买的是阿里云学生服务器,24岁以下是自动认证为学生的,一个ECS服务器一个月9.5元,一年114元(顶上我一天工资了。。。)下面是阿里云的ECS链接。
阿里云学生服务器入口
地域选离你最近的,系统镜像最好选linux的,有Ubuntu和CentOS两种选择。
这里由于我比较喜欢控制台操作装逼,所以选择了CentOs,如果你也觉得用控制台操作很nice,那可以选和我一样的。

使用ssh远程连接服务器的两种方式

1.用户名密码: 控制台输入
ssh [email protected]             #root为用户名 114.xx.1xx.1xx是你的服务器的公网ip

Enter后会提示输入密码,输入你登陆实例的密码。
看到Welcome to Alibaba Cloud Elastic Compute Service !代表登陆成功啦!

2.通过公钥登陆
第一步:本地创建密钥对
ssh-keygen -t rsa   #-t表示类型选项,这里采用rsa加密算法

然后根据提示一步步的按enter键即可(其中有一个提示是要求设置私钥口令passphrase,不设置则为空,这里看心情吧,如果不放心私钥的安全可以设置一下),执行结束以后会在 /home/当前用户 目录下生成一个 .ssh 文件夹,其中包含私钥文件 id_rsa 和公钥文件 id_rsa.pub。

第二步:使用ssh将公钥上传到服务器上
ssh-copy-id [email protected]             #root为用户名 114.xx.1xx.1xx是你的服务器的公网ip

这个操作是将公钥复制到服务器。ssh-copy-id会将公钥写到服务器的 ~/ .ssh/authorized_key 文件中。
操作完的好处就是以后你可以免去输入密码的那一步,直接通过下面就可连接。

ssh [email protected]             #root为用户名 114.xx.1xx.1xx是你的服务器的公网ip

下一篇会写一下如何配置nginx

猜你喜欢

转载自blog.csdn.net/qq_42199786/article/details/100172610